SQL Server 7参考手册

SQL Server 7参考手册 pdf epub mobi txt 电子书 下载 2026

出版者:北京希望电脑公司
作者:北京希望电子出版社
出品人:
页数:0
译者:
出版时间:1999-11-01
价格:62.0
装帧:
isbn号码:9787900024770
丛书系列:
图书标签:
  • SQL Server
  • 数据库
  • SQL
  • 参考手册
  • 7
  • 0
  • 编程
  • 开发
  • 技术
  • 书籍
  • 工具书
想要找书就要到 图书目录大全
立刻按 ctrl+D收藏本页
你会得到大惊喜!!

具体描述

本书是SQL Server 7数据库开发系列丛书之一。该丛书是为数据库专业人员编写的经典丛书,其内容由浅入深,通俗易懂,全套丛书共有四本,它们是《SQL Server 7循序渐进教程》、 《SQL Server 7参考手册》、 《SQL Server 7开发人员指南》和《SQL Server 7数据仓库》。本书是学习和掌握关系数据库系统SQL Server 7的人门指导书。全书由五大部分共23章组

深入探索现代数据库管理与架构:面向云原生时代的实践指南 图书名称: 云端数据基石:PostgreSQL 16与分布式事务处理 图书简介: 本书旨在为资深的数据库管理员、系统架构师以及寻求精通下一代数据库技术栈的开发人员,提供一套全面、深入且极具前瞻性的技术指南。在当前计算环境日益向云原生和高可用性迁移的背景下,单一集中式数据库的局限性日益凸显。我们聚焦于当前开源数据库领域的领跑者——PostgreSQL(特别是其最新的16版本),并将其与现代分布式事务处理(Distributed Transaction Processing, DTP)架构相结合,构建一套面向高并发、高可靠、可伸缩的企业级数据解决方案。 本书内容绝不涉及微软SQL Server 7.0的相关技术细节,它完全专注于构建和维护基于PostgreSQL的现代数据平台。 第一部分:PostgreSQL 16核心机制的深度剖析 本部分将彻底解构PostgreSQL 16版本引入的关键特性、性能优化点以及底层架构的精妙之处。我们将超越基础的SQL查询和索引创建,深入到数据库引擎的内部运作机制。 1.1 存储引擎与内存管理: 我们将详细分析PostgreSQL的堆表结构、TOAST(The Oversized-Attribute Storage Technique)机制的最新演进,以及如何根据工作负载精细调优共享缓冲区(Shared Buffers)、WAL缓冲区(WAL Buffers)和工作内存(Work Mem)。讨论针对SSD和NVMe存储介质的优化策略,包括如何调整`random_page_cost`和`seq_page_cost`以匹配物理I/O特性。 1.2 并发控制与锁机制的重构: 深入探讨PostgreSQL的MVCC(多版本并发控制)如何应对高并发读写场景。分析最新的锁升级行为、死锁检测算法的性能提升,并提供实战案例演示如何通过分析`pg_locks`视图来诊断和解决复杂的锁等待问题,特别是针对大事务和长查询导致的锁阻塞。 1.3 逻辑解码与变更数据捕获(CDC)的未来: 重点讲解PostgreSQL 16中逻辑解码(Logical Decoding)的性能优化和新的输出插件。我们不仅会介绍标准的`pgoutput`,还会深入探究如何构建自定义的解码逻辑,以实现低延迟、高吞吐的实时数据同步管道,为后续的分布式架构奠定基础。 1.4 查询规划器与优化器的精细调优: 不再满足于接受默认的查询计划。本章将指导读者如何解读复杂的执行计划,特别是涉及到JIT编译(Just-In-Time Compilation)的场景。我们将演示如何利用统计信息增强(Extended Statistics)和自定义的查询优化器提示(Hints的间接实现方式),以驯服那些难以优化的复杂联接和聚合操作。 第二部分:构建高可用与容灾体系 在现代业务对“零停机”有着苛刻要求的背景下,构建健壮的高可用(HA)架构至关重要。本部分聚焦于如何利用PostgreSQL原生的复制机制和外部工具,构建企业级的灾难恢复(DR)和高可用集群。 2.1 流复制的进阶配置与故障转移: 详细对比同步复制(Synchronous Replication)与异步复制的性能权衡。我们将使用Patroni作为核心的自动化管理工具,涵盖其与etcd/Consul/ZooKeeper的集成,实现自动的集群成员管理、领导者选举以及无缝的自动故障转移。不再依赖手动的`pg_ctl promote`操作。 2.2 跨区域灾难恢复与数据一致性保证: 探讨使用物理复制结合VPN或专线实现跨数据中心(Region-to-Region)的部署策略。重点解决跨广域网环境下的复制延迟问题,以及在发生灾难时如何验证数据一致性(例如,使用时间戳或LSN校验)。 2.3 读写分离与负载均衡实践: 介绍如何利用pgBouncer(连接池管理器)和Pgpool-II(查询路由层)构建高效的读写分离架构。深入配置路由规则,确保事务性请求被正确引导至主库,同时将分析查询均匀分散到多个只读副本上,最大限度地提升整体系统吞吐量。 第三部分:分布式事务处理(DTP)与数据分片策略 本部分是本书的价值核心,它将PostgreSQL从一个强大的单体数据库,扩展为分布式系统中的关键数据服务。我们完全避开传统集中式数据库的垂直扩展限制,转而采用水平扩展模型。 3.1 分布式系统的理论基础与挑战: 简要回顾CAP理论,并重点讨论在PostgreSQL生态中如何应用BASE原则。分析分布式事务的原子性、一致性、隔离性(ACI)的实现难题,特别是两阶段提交(2PC)在广域网下的性能瓶颈。 3.2 声明式分片解决方案:CitusData深度解析: 本书将CitusData(现已集成至PostgreSQL生态)作为实现声明式分片的首选工具进行详尽阐述。 分片键的选择艺术: 讨论如何选择合适的分片键(Distribution Key)以避免热点(Hot Spot)和数据倾斜(Data Skew)。 查询重写与分布式执行: 剖析Citus如何将复杂的SQL查询分解为本地查询和分布式查询,并通过协调节点(Coordinator Node)进行聚合。 多租户架构实现: 演示如何利用Citus的混合分片模型(引用表与分片表)高效地支持大规模多租户SaaS应用的数据隔离和查询优化。 3.3 事务性一致性的替代方案:Saga模式与补偿逻辑: 针对高并发、低延迟要求的场景,放弃严格的分布式ACID,转而采用最终一致性模型。详细设计和实现基于Saga模式的分布式业务流程,包括幂等性处理、补偿事务的设计与监控。 第四部分:性能监控、安全加固与运维自动化 最后一部分关注于生产环境的成熟度要求,确保数据平台能够稳定、安全地运行。 4.1 现代监控栈的集成: 指导读者如何利用Prometheus和Grafana构建PostgreSQL专用的监控仪表盘。关注关键的“黄金信号”:延迟、流量、错误率和饱和度,特别是WAL写入速率、复制延迟和锁等待时间的实时可视化。 4.2 数据安全与合规性: 强化基于角色的访问控制(RBAC),实施行级安全(Row Level Security, RLS)策略。介绍使用pgAudit进行详细的活动日志记录,以满足合规性要求,并探讨数据加密(静态加密与传输中加密)的最佳实践。 4.3 自动化部署与基础设施即代码(IaC): 利用Terraform和Ansible,实现PostgreSQL集群的自动化部署、配置管理和滚动升级流程。展示如何编写模块化的配置脚本,确保不同环境间配置的一致性。 本书内容紧密围绕PostgreSQL的生态系统及其在分布式环境下的应用实践,为构建面向未来挑战的数据基础设施提供了一条清晰的技术路径。全书强调实践操作和深度原理分析的结合,致力于培养读者解决复杂数据系统问题的能力。

作者简介

目录信息

读后感

评分

评分

评分

评分

评分

用户评价

评分

我拿到这本《SQL Server 7 参考手册》纯属机缘巧合,当时正在进行一个关于数据库迁移的项目,需要快速熟悉 SQL Server 7 的一些特性,以便更好地评估兼容性和制定迁移方案。老实说,在拿到这本书之前,我对 SQL Server 7 的了解仅限于一些基础的查询语句。这本书的出现,简直就是雪中送炭。它的内容组织非常合理,从入门级的数据库对象讲解,到进阶的数据完整性约束,再到更复杂的事务管理和并发控制,层层递进,逻辑清晰。书中对于每个概念的解释都非常透彻,而且不会回避一些容易混淆或者容易出错的地方,会给出详细的说明和注意事项。我特别喜欢书中关于性能调优的部分,里面详细介绍了各种索引策略、查询优化器的工作原理,以及如何通过分析执行计划来定位性能瓶颈。这些知识对于我处理实际项目中遇到的性能问题非常有指导意义。虽然我主要关注的是技术实现,但这本书也包含了一些关于数据库架构设计和安全性考虑的章节,让我对整个数据库体系有了更全面的认识。总的来说,这是一本内容丰富、讲解深入、实操性强的参考书,对于任何需要深入了解 SQL Server 7 的开发者或管理员来说,都具有极高的价值。

评分

作为一名资深的 IT 从业者,我对技术文档的质量有着很高的要求。这本书《SQL Server 7 参考手册》,给我的第一印象就是其内容的严谨性和专业性。在阅读过程中,我发现它对 SQL Server 7 的各个方面都有着深入的探讨,从基础的表结构设计,到高级的数据挖掘和文本搜索功能,都进行了细致的阐述。这本书的语言风格非常专业,但又足够清晰易懂,不会使用过于晦涩的术语。它通过大量的图示和代码示例,将复杂的概念形象化,大大降低了理解的难度。我尤其喜欢书中关于分布式事务处理和高可用性解决方案的章节,这些内容对于构建大型、复杂的企业级应用至关重要。这本书不仅讲解了“如何做”,还深入分析了“为什么这样做”,以及在不同场景下应该如何权衡和选择。这种深度和广度,使得这本书不仅仅是一本工具书,更是一本能够帮助读者提升技术视野和解决实际问题的宝典。尽管我可能已经掌握了其中的一部分内容,但每次阅读,总能发现新的亮点和值得借鉴的经验。

评分

当我拿到这本《SQL Server 7 参考手册》时,我正在为一个新项目寻找一个可靠的数据库解决方案。当时我对 SQL Server 7 并不是非常熟悉,但听闻其强大的功能和广泛的应用,所以决定深入了解一下。这本书的内容确实没有让我失望,它的讲解非常系统和全面,从数据库的安装、配置,到各种数据类型的介绍,再到 SQL 查询语言的详细解析,几乎涵盖了 SQL Server 7 的所有核心功能。我特别欣赏书中关于索引和查询优化的章节,它们提供了非常实用的方法和技巧,可以帮助开发者显著提升数据库的查询性能。书中还详细介绍了如何利用存储过程和触发器来实现复杂的业务逻辑,以及如何设计和管理数据库的安全权限。对于我这种需要快速上手并投入实际工作的开发者来说,这本书的实用性非常高。它提供的代码示例清晰明了,并且往往会解释代码背后的设计思路,这对于我理解和应用这些技术非常有帮助。这本书不仅仅是一本参考书,更像是一位经验丰富的导师,在我遇到技术难题时,总能提供及时有效的指导。

评分

我一直对数据库技术抱有浓厚的兴趣,尤其是在工作中接触到 SQL Server 后,更是渴望能够系统地学习和掌握它。朋友推荐了这本《SQL Server 7 参考手册》,我毫不犹豫地入手了。初次翻阅,就被其庞大的篇幅和细致的内容所震撼。这本书的编排结构非常到位,从最基础的 SQL 语句和数据库概念,一直深入到高级的数据仓库和商业智能应用。我尤其对其中关于存储过程、函数和触发器的讲解印象深刻,书中不仅提供了大量的代码示例,还对每个示例的逻辑和应用场景进行了详细的分析,让我能够举一反三。此外,书中关于数据安全和备份恢复的章节也让我受益匪浅。在实际工作中,数据库的稳定性和安全性是至关重要的,这本书为我提供了很多宝贵的经验和实用的技巧。它不像某些教程那样只注重“做什么”,而是花了很多篇幅去解释“为什么这样做”,以及“这样做的好处和坏处”。这种深入浅出的讲解方式,让我能够真正理解技术背后的原理,而不是仅仅停留在表面。这本书无疑是我 SQL Server 学习路上的重要基石。

评分

这本书的封面设计非常经典,给人一种厚重而专业的感觉,让人一看就觉得内容会很扎实。我是在一次偶然的机会下,在朋友的书架上看到的。当时我正在学习 SQL Server 的一些高级特性,感觉现有的资料有些零散,急需一本系统性的参考书。翻看目录的时候,就被其详尽的章节划分所吸引,几乎涵盖了 SQL Server 7 中我能想到和想不到的方方面面。从基础的安装配置,到存储过程、触发器、视图等对象的使用,再到性能优化、安全管理、备份恢复策略,甚至连一些比较冷门的特性,这本书都做了深入的讲解。虽然我还没有完全读完,但每次翻开它,都能从中找到我需要的答案,而且往往还能发现一些我之前未曾注意到的技巧和最佳实践。这本书的语言风格比较严谨,但又不至于枯燥乏味,很多地方都配有清晰的代码示例,这对于理解抽象的概念非常有帮助。我尤其欣赏的是它在介绍某个功能时,不仅会说明“是什么”,更会深入剖析“为什么”以及“如何用好”,这种钻研精神是很多同类书籍所缺乏的。总的来说,这是一本非常值得拥有,并且能够陪伴我 SQL Server 学习之路的优秀参考手册。

评分

评分

评分

评分

评分

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 book.wenda123.org All Rights Reserved. 图书目录大全 版权所有